EMIT Learning is seeking an experienced Special Education Teacher for Visually Impaired students for a full-time, onsite position in Mountain View, CA for the 2026-2027 school year. The Special Education Teacher for Visually Impaired will provide specialized instruction, adapt curriculum, support IEP implementation, and use assistive technology and tactile materials to help students access learning. This role works closely with students, families, teachers, therapists, and school-based teams to support academic, social, behavioral, and functional growth.Location:

Design and deliver individualized lesson plans for students with visual impairments. Use specialized instructional strategies, assistive technology, tactile materials, and learning technology tools. Collaborate with multidisciplinary teams to develop, review, and implement Individualized Education Programs, IEPs. Set and support clear academic, social, behavioral, communication, and functional goals for students. Adapt curriculum across subjects, including literacy, math, early childhood education, and related learning areas. Provide direct instruction in communication skills, sensory integration strategies, and functional learning skills. Support behavioral management strategies and positive behavior interventions. Monitor student progress and maintain accurate documentation. Collaborate with general education teachers, special education staff, therapists, families, and school administrators. Support students across grade levels based on individual needs. Maintain compliance with special education requirements, school policies, and IEP documentation standards.Qualifications:
Bachelor's degree in Special Education, Childhood Development, Education, or a related field required. Master's degree preferred. Valid California Education Specialist Instruction Credential with Visual Impairments Authorization required. Teaching certification with specialization, endorsement, or authorization in visual impairments required. Strong knowledge of assistive technology, tactile learning materials, and adaptive instructional tools. Experience developing and implementing IEPs. Experience with curriculum development for students with visual impairments. Knowledge of behavioral therapy, behavior intervention, or applied behavior analysis strategies preferred. Strong communication, organization, and documentation skills. Ability to collaborate with students, families, therapists, teachers, and school staff.
